Output f3208304963741d4e7e9e498efb39e8f40c4792ba290fd0e455dd990602649a2:1

value
6642
script pubkey
OP_0 OP_PUSHBYTES_20 3cae5ac58db013bccd60e566140b9b7024d8c16a
address
bc1q8jh943vdkqfmentqu4npgzumwqjd3st2gdnqkz
transaction
f3208304963741d4e7e9e498efb39e8f40c4792ba290fd0e455dd990602649a2
confirmations
95534
spent
false